La Chapelle-Engerbold (French pronunciation: [la ʃapɛl ɑ̃ʒɛʁbo][2] or [la ʃapɛl ɑ̃ʒɛʁbɔld][3]) is a former commune in the Calvados department in the Normandy region in northwestern France. On 1 January 2016, it was merged into the new commune of Condé-en-Normandie.[4]

The former commune is part of the area known as Suisse Normande.[5]
